

More: Hit game-winning free throw in Tech's upset of seventh-ranked N.C. State 1/5/97...Started 24 of 27 games during 1995-96 in first season with Lady Jackets...scored career-high 20 points against Wake Forest 1/10/96...posted nine assist effort vs. Manhattan 12/3/95...collected 13 points with career-high nine rebounds and four steals in upset of 18th-ranked Clemson 1/25/96...sat out 1994-95 campaign after transferring from the University of Connecticut...First team all-state at New Jersey's Egg Harbor Township High School as both a junior and senior...completed high school career as Cape-Atlantic League's all-time leading scorer with 2,167 points....served as graduate assistant coach at Life University during 1999-2000 season.
